Citadel was interesting, we did the underground tour and...
Citadel was interesting, we did the underground tour and really enjoyed it. Cable car was fun, good views, busier going up than down. There are river boat tours too.
Town centre was pretty and nice for wandering around, plenty bars restaurants.
A good base for exploring the wider area.

Beautifull, not too big city with loads of visible history,...
Beautifull, not too big city with loads of visible history, characteristic buildings and architecture dating back to medieval times. A cosy but also mondain historic city center with loads of good bars and restaurants and cultural events. During daytime and summer its widely visited by tourists and one has to be able to accept that. Its logical when a city has that much to offer and is so hospital. Despite the Poor Hotel de Lives we stayed, the people in the city helped us out where we lacked knowledge of french language. A big difference with 30 years ago when peuple du wallon would not speak any other word then their french. Now I met people being proud to also speak dutch AND fair english, which is great when they work in hospitality or restaurants. From here a daytrip to Dinant where the saxophone was invented is worth the trouble as its only a half hr countryside drive. Every N road in belgium is worth roadtripping as there are objects everywhere. The highways are mostly flanked by trees, and often in not a good shape. I call them "launch surface" as on parts of the road 2 of 4 wheels are always detached from the road that bumpy it is. And that is fun but drive carefully and save, to see as much as you can. You can see the city and citadel in a day if you hurry a bit, but 2 nights/3days is perfect if you like to take things easy but want to see it all. It is also the capital of Wallonie, and a perfect base to make diverse trips in any direction, all reachable within half an hour. Brussels, Waterloo, Abbaye Villiers, Dinant, Coal Mines and streetart in Charleroi etcetera. Have fun!
